Output 57e7f352bf0b8ad42ca8a1bf6d95b828e5ce838dd77c45997ee20d8087f09ea8:0

value
2358412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2068c7341ee3ce913678882e394e726935563c54 OP_EQUAL
address
34eP4o4psMvdCnfCZYBU9HcicUGfLyJwvt
transaction
57e7f352bf0b8ad42ca8a1bf6d95b828e5ce838dd77c45997ee20d8087f09ea8
confirmations
383989
spent
true